Output 583628a3b0be4ef00c714245b4b504bf62b185f43cee95e351cb16915a1dc3f1:0

value
6969946766409
script pubkey
OP_0 OP_PUSHBYTES_20 e63b134324c4f150556daf3979312f730460b69d
address
tb1quca3xseycnc4q4td4uuhjvf0wvzxpd5auh5ets
transaction
583628a3b0be4ef00c714245b4b504bf62b185f43cee95e351cb16915a1dc3f1
confirmations
174082
spent
true